生物黏附制剂的研究进展

摘    要:目的对生物黏附制剂研究进展进行综述。方法参考近几年国内外文献30余篇,介绍利用生物黏附材料作为制剂载体,以给药途径的不同阐述生物黏附新剂型的研究进展。结果目前生物黏附制剂给药途径一般分为口腔给药、眼部给药、鼻黏膜给药、胃肠道给药和阴道盆腔给药。利用各种具有生物黏附功能的辅料,制备不同剂型的制剂,给药后黏附于特定给药部位,可以控制释药速率,提高靶部位药物浓度,进而提高疗效。结论归纳总结国内外生物黏附制剂最新研究进展,生物黏附制剂具有良好的缓、控释释药及靶向给药等优势,具有较高的市场开发潜力。

Advances on the bioadhesive preparations

Abstract:Objective To summarize the recent research and development of the bioadhesive preparation. Methods According to some domestic and foreign literatures, the application of bioadhesive new dosage forms in different routes of administration were reviewed. Results The routes of administration of bioadhesive preparations are generally divided into ocular administration, gastrointestinal administration, oral administration, intranasal administration, vaginal pelvic administration. Some bioadhesive excipients were used to prepare different dosage forms which can adhere to the sites of administration. Because of the controlling rates of drug delivery and the high drug concentration of the administration sites, therapeutic effects could be improved. Conclusions The bioadhesive preparations have great advantages in extended-release and controlled-release and targeting properties, reflecting the strong market development potential.
